Civil Engineer Jobs in Canada

About 4687 results in (6) seconds Clear Filters

Jobs Search

About 4687 results in (6) seconds
Full Stack Engineer at BusPlanner
Waterloo, ON, Canada - Full Time
Skills Needed
Architectural Patterns, Web Applications, Javascript, Sql, Database Design, Bootstrap, Git, Mvc, Design Principles, Asp.Net, C++, Computer Science, Object Oriented Programming, Mysql
Specialization
Computer science engineering or related field or equivalent experience
Qualification
Graduate
Stormwater Engineer at Arcadis
Edmonton, Alberta, Canada - Full Time
Skills Needed
Hydrological Modelling, Hydraulic Modelling, Data Collection, Design Review, Model Setup, Calibration, System Assessment, Stormwater Servicing Plans, Rainwater Source Control, Lid Concepts, Technical Analysis, Quality Control, Peer Review, Cad Design, Project Coordination, Client Relationship Management
Specialization
Candidates must have a Bachelor's degree in Civil Engineering or a related field and be registered as a professional engineer or EIT with APEGA. A minimum of 3 years of experience in stormwater systems assessment, modeling, and design is required.
Experience Required
Minimum 2 year(s)
IT Support Engineer at NextGen Automation
Edmonton, AB T5V 0A2, Canada - Full Time
Skills Needed
It
Qualification
Graduate
Experience Required
Minimum 1 year(s)
Full Stack Engineer at Knotch Inc
Remote, British Columbia, Canada - Full Time
Skills Needed
Relational Databases, Communication Skills, Sql, Cloud Services, Postgresql, Technical Proficiency, Infrastructure
Qualification
Graduate
Experience Required
Minimum 4 year(s)
Mechanical Engineer at Spirit Omega Inc
Fort McMurray, AB, Canada - Full Time
Skills Needed
Disabilities
Qualification
Graduate
Experience Required
Minimum 5 year(s)
mechanical engineer at CTS Canadian Technology Systems
Pointe-Claire, QC, Canada - Full Time
Skills Needed
Technology
Qualification
Graduate
Mechanical Engineer at TalentSphere
Calgary, AB, Canada - Full Time
Skills Needed
Good Communication Skills
Qualification
Graduate
Experience Required
Minimum 7 year(s)
AWS DevOps Engineer at Atlantis IT group
Vancouver, BC V6Z 0A1, Canada - Full Time
Skills Needed
Good Communication Skills
Qualification
Graduate
Engineering Student at PCL Construction
Nisku, AB, Canada - Full Time
Skills Needed
Utilities, Matching, Color, Healing, Pcl, Access, Career Development Programs, Word Processing
Specialization
Engineering
Qualification
Diploma
Structural Engineer at Capex Construction LTD
Ottawa, ON K2A 1H2, Canada - Full Time
Skills Needed
Good Communication Skills
Qualification
Graduate
Agentic AI Engineer at Behavox Ltd
Montreal, Quebec, Canada - Full Time
Skills Needed
Ai Agents, Large Language Models, Python, Mlops, Cloud Platforms, Devops, Production Ai Development, Agentic Concepts, Engineering Tools, Technical Leadership, Collaboration, Innovation, Optimization, Research Application, Architecting Ai Systems, Problem Solving
Specialization
Candidates should have extensive experience in building production-grade LLM-powered applications and mastery of agentic concepts. Strong Python skills and familiarity with cloud platforms are also essential.
Experience Required
Minimum 5 year(s)
IT Systems Engineer at Brock Canada
Nisku, AB, Canada - Full Time
Skills Needed
Leadership, Virtualization, It
Specialization
It or related field (or equivalent experience/certifications
Qualification
Graduate
Experience Required
Minimum 7 year(s)
Engineering Manager at Marmon Holdings
Calgary, AB, Canada - Full Time
Skills Needed
Good Communication Skills
Qualification
Graduate
Experience Required
Minimum 11 year(s)
Software Engineer I at TD Bank
Toronto, ON, Canada - Full Time
Skills Needed
Computer Science, Academic Background
Specialization
Undergraduate degree postgraduate degree or technical certificate
Qualification
Trade Certificate
Experience Required
Minimum 2 year(s)
Engineering Manager at Amphenol Communications Solutions
Markham, ON, Canada - Full Time
Skills Needed
Manufacturing, Signal Integrity, Working Experience, Sfp, Design, Connectors, Injection Molding, Solidworks, Automated Processes, Communication Skills
Specialization
Mechanical engineering or equivalent
Qualification
Graduate
Experience Required
Minimum 10 year(s)
Head of Engineering at LTV
Toronto, ON, Canada - Full Time
Skills Needed
Good Communication Skills
Qualification
Graduate
Experience Required
Minimum 8 year(s)
Engineering Manager at Sprout Social
, , Canada - Full Time
Skills Needed
Engineering Leadership, Back End Development, Software Systems, Team Management, Technical Roadmaps, Data Metrics, Distributed Applications, Service Oriented Architectures, Elasticsearch, Mysql, Hbase, Java, Python, C#, C++
Specialization
Candidates should have over 5 years of experience in enterprise-level software systems and over 4 years of experience managing engineering teams. A strong emphasis on delivery, execution, and achieving measurable business outcomes is required.
Experience Required
Minimum 5 year(s)
Engineering Manager at De Beers Group of Companies
Yellowknife, NT X1A 1P8, Canada - Full Time
Skills Needed
Asset Management, Organizational Performance, Mining, Lean Management, Work Processes, Processing, Six Sigma, X, Infrastructure, Contract Management, Health
Specialization
The field of mine engineering
Qualification
Diploma
Structural Engineer at Makami Engineering Group Ltd
Sault Ste. Marie, ON P6A 2A9, Canada - Full Time
Skills Needed
Good Communication Skills
Qualification
Graduate
Experience Required
Minimum 5 year(s)
Structural Engineer at Chernenko Engineering Ltd
Edmonton, AB T6E 4E7, Canada - Full Time
Skills Needed
Infrastructure, Dental Care, Collaboration, Civil Engineering, Communication Skills, Structural Engineering, Life Insurance, Building Codes, S Frame, Analytical Skills, Project Management Skills, Materials
Specialization
Civil engineering or a related field master’s degree is a plus
Qualification
Graduate
Full Stack Engineer at BusPlanner
Waterloo, ON, Canada -
Full Time


Start Date

Immediate

Expiry Date

19 Nov, 25

Salary

0.0

Posted On

20 Aug, 25

Experience

0 year(s) or above

Remote Job

Yes

Telecommute

Yes

Sponsor Visa

No

Skills

Architectural Patterns, Web Applications, Javascript, Sql, Database Design, Bootstrap, Git, Mvc, Design Principles, Asp.Net, C++, Computer Science, Object Oriented Programming, Mysql

Industry

Computer Software/Engineering

Description

POSITION OVERVIEW

We’re looking for a Fullstack Developer with strong experience in C++ and .NET to help build and maintain our flagship platform, BusPlanner Pro, and related web-based tools. The ideal candidate will be deeply comfortable working in back-end systems, with additional exposure to front-end development using ASP.NET MVC, JavaScript, and Bootstrap.
This is a backend-heavy role - but the ability to contribute to UI development and collaborate across the full stack is important. Our environment includes C++ for core business logic, .NET/C# for web applications, and SQL Server/MySQL for data access. We deploy on IBM Cloud and use Azure DevOps-managed CI/CD pipelines.

REQUIRED QUALIFICATIONS

  • Bachelor’s degree in Computer Science, Engineering, or related field — or equivalent experience.
  • Solid professional experience with C++ in a production environment.
  • Strong experience developing web applications using .NET, C#, and ASP.NET MVC.
  • Familiarity with front-end technologies: JavaScript, Bootstrap, HTML5, and CSS3.
  • Experience working with RESTful APIs, software design principles, and architectural patterns.
  • Strong grasp of object-oriented programming (OOP) and performance optimization.
  • Proficiency with SQL, MySQL, and relational database design.
  • Experience using Git or equivalent version control systems.
  • Strong analytical and problem-solving skills; able to work both independently and as part of a team.

How To Apply:

Incase you would like to apply to this job directly from the source, please click here

Responsibilities
  • Contribute to the development and maintenance of BusPlanner Pro, written in C++.
  • Build and support web applications using ASP.NET MVC, C#, and .NET Framework/Core.
  • Support front-end development using JavaScript, HTML5, CSS3, and Bootstrap.
  • Collaborate with cross-functional teams (Product, UI/UX, QA) to deliver reliable, high-quality software.
  • Write clean, maintainable, well-documented code across both front-end and back-end components.
  • Develop and optimize SQL queries and integrate with relational databases like MySQL.
  • Participate in peer code reviews, CI/CD processes, and DevOps-based release workflows.
  • Investigate, debug, and resolve issues in both legacy and modern systems.
Full Stack Engineer at BusPlanner
Waterloo, ON, Canada - Full Time
Skills Needed
Architectural Patterns, Web Applications, Javascript, Sql, Database Design, Bootstrap, Git, Mvc, Design Principles, Asp.Net, C++, Computer Science, Object Oriented Programming, Mysql
Specialization
Computer science engineering or related field or equivalent experience
Qualification
Graduate
Stormwater Engineer at Arcadis
Edmonton, Alberta, Canada - Full Time
Skills Needed
Hydrological Modelling, Hydraulic Modelling, Data Collection, Design Review, Model Setup, Calibration, System Assessment, Stormwater Servicing Plans, Rainwater Source Control, Lid Concepts, Technical Analysis, Quality Control, Peer Review, Cad Design, Project Coordination, Client Relationship Management
Specialization
Candidates must have a Bachelor's degree in Civil Engineering or a related field and be registered as a professional engineer or EIT with APEGA. A minimum of 3 years of experience in stormwater systems assessment, modeling, and design is required.
Experience Required
Minimum 2 year(s)
IT Support Engineer at NextGen Automation
Edmonton, AB T5V 0A2, Canada - Full Time
Skills Needed
It
Qualification
Graduate
Experience Required
Minimum 1 year(s)
Full Stack Engineer at Knotch Inc
Remote, British Columbia, Canada - Full Time
Skills Needed
Relational Databases, Communication Skills, Sql, Cloud Services, Postgresql, Technical Proficiency, Infrastructure
Qualification
Graduate
Experience Required
Minimum 4 year(s)
Mechanical Engineer at Spirit Omega Inc
Fort McMurray, AB, Canada - Full Time
Skills Needed
Disabilities
Qualification
Graduate
Experience Required
Minimum 5 year(s)
mechanical engineer at CTS Canadian Technology Systems
Pointe-Claire, QC, Canada - Full Time
Skills Needed
Technology
Qualification
Graduate
Mechanical Engineer at TalentSphere
Calgary, AB, Canada - Full Time
Skills Needed
Good Communication Skills
Qualification
Graduate
Experience Required
Minimum 7 year(s)
AWS DevOps Engineer at Atlantis IT group
Vancouver, BC V6Z 0A1, Canada - Full Time
Skills Needed
Good Communication Skills
Qualification
Graduate
Engineering Student at PCL Construction
Nisku, AB, Canada - Full Time
Skills Needed
Utilities, Matching, Color, Healing, Pcl, Access, Career Development Programs, Word Processing
Specialization
Engineering
Qualification
Diploma
Structural Engineer at Capex Construction LTD
Ottawa, ON K2A 1H2, Canada - Full Time
Skills Needed
Good Communication Skills
Qualification
Graduate
Agentic AI Engineer at Behavox Ltd
Montreal, Quebec, Canada - Full Time
Skills Needed
Ai Agents, Large Language Models, Python, Mlops, Cloud Platforms, Devops, Production Ai Development, Agentic Concepts, Engineering Tools, Technical Leadership, Collaboration, Innovation, Optimization, Research Application, Architecting Ai Systems, Problem Solving
Specialization
Candidates should have extensive experience in building production-grade LLM-powered applications and mastery of agentic concepts. Strong Python skills and familiarity with cloud platforms are also essential.
Experience Required
Minimum 5 year(s)
IT Systems Engineer at Brock Canada
Nisku, AB, Canada - Full Time
Skills Needed
Leadership, Virtualization, It
Specialization
It or related field (or equivalent experience/certifications
Qualification
Graduate
Experience Required
Minimum 7 year(s)
Engineering Manager at Marmon Holdings
Calgary, AB, Canada - Full Time
Skills Needed
Good Communication Skills
Qualification
Graduate
Experience Required
Minimum 11 year(s)
Software Engineer I at TD Bank
Toronto, ON, Canada - Full Time
Skills Needed
Computer Science, Academic Background
Specialization
Undergraduate degree postgraduate degree or technical certificate
Qualification
Trade Certificate
Experience Required
Minimum 2 year(s)
Engineering Manager at Amphenol Communications Solutions
Markham, ON, Canada - Full Time
Skills Needed
Manufacturing, Signal Integrity, Working Experience, Sfp, Design, Connectors, Injection Molding, Solidworks, Automated Processes, Communication Skills
Specialization
Mechanical engineering or equivalent
Qualification
Graduate
Experience Required
Minimum 10 year(s)
Head of Engineering at LTV
Toronto, ON, Canada - Full Time
Skills Needed
Good Communication Skills
Qualification
Graduate
Experience Required
Minimum 8 year(s)
Engineering Manager at Sprout Social
, , Canada - Full Time
Skills Needed
Engineering Leadership, Back End Development, Software Systems, Team Management, Technical Roadmaps, Data Metrics, Distributed Applications, Service Oriented Architectures, Elasticsearch, Mysql, Hbase, Java, Python, C#, C++
Specialization
Candidates should have over 5 years of experience in enterprise-level software systems and over 4 years of experience managing engineering teams. A strong emphasis on delivery, execution, and achieving measurable business outcomes is required.
Experience Required
Minimum 5 year(s)
Engineering Manager at De Beers Group of Companies
Yellowknife, NT X1A 1P8, Canada - Full Time
Skills Needed
Asset Management, Organizational Performance, Mining, Lean Management, Work Processes, Processing, Six Sigma, X, Infrastructure, Contract Management, Health
Specialization
The field of mine engineering
Qualification
Diploma
Structural Engineer at Makami Engineering Group Ltd
Sault Ste. Marie, ON P6A 2A9, Canada - Full Time
Skills Needed
Good Communication Skills
Qualification
Graduate
Experience Required
Minimum 5 year(s)
Structural Engineer at Chernenko Engineering Ltd
Edmonton, AB T6E 4E7, Canada - Full Time
Skills Needed
Infrastructure, Dental Care, Collaboration, Civil Engineering, Communication Skills, Structural Engineering, Life Insurance, Building Codes, S Frame, Analytical Skills, Project Management Skills, Materials
Specialization
Civil engineering or a related field master’s degree is a plus
Qualification
Graduate
Loading...